ProNovos Background
ProNovos was founded in 2019 to bring modern financial intelligence to an industry that has historically relied on manual, spreadsheet-driven processes for job costing, WIP reporting, and cash flow management. The platform was built specifically for construction and connects directly into the ERP systems contractors already use, rather than asking them to replace their existing financial infrastructure.
ProNovos serves construction CFOs, controllers, CEOs and owners, project managers, and subcontractors across the United States.
Who ProNovos Serves
ProNovos serves commercial contractors in the United States, including both general contractors and specialty/subcontractors, with an ideal customer revenue range of $10M to $100M.

Core Service Offerings
Nova — An AI-driven financial intelligence platform for construction finance. Nova lets users ask natural-language questions about their financial data, in English or Spanish, and get direct answers, rather than building reports manually. Specific capabilities include:
- Voice-to-daily-report generation
- Natural-language WIP chart building
- AR email drafting
- Invoice line item extraction
QuickPay Direct (QPD) — A spot factoring / payment acceleration tool that lets contractors and subcontractors get paid faster on individual outstanding invoices, on their own terms. QPD is designed as a strategic working capital tool, preserving line-of-credit utilization and bonding capacity, rather than a distress or emergency cash tool. QPD is not a payment processor.
QuickPay — Lets general contractors offer their subcontractors early payment. ProNovos's working capital partner, Viva Capital, funds the advances; subcontractors get paid faster, and the GC earns rebates based on how quickly they're repaid. There is no cost to the GC.
13-Week Cash Flow Forecasting Tool — A forecasting tool purpose-built for construction, giving finance teams forward visibility into cash position.
ERP Integrations
ProNovos integrates with the ERP systems most widely used in construction: Foundation, Sage 300, Sage 100, Sage Intacct, Viewpoint Vista, Viewpoint Spectrum, Acumatica, QuickBooks Online, and ComputerEase.

What is an RFI in construction?
An RFI, or Request for Information, is a formal question a contractor sends to the design team or owner to clarify something unclear or missing in the drawings or specs, so the work can proceed correctly.
What's the difference between an RFI and a submittal?
An RFI is a request for information used to clarify the design. A submittal provides information for approval, such as product data, shop drawings, or samples, to show that what you intend to install meets the spec. One seeks an answer; the other seeks sign-off.
How do I keep RFIs and submittals from slipping through the cracks?
Track them where the job lives, with status and what's overdue visible at a glance, and tie them to the job's cost and schedule so the impact is clear. Nova does this so nothing stalls between the field and the office.
What's the difference between a change order and an RFI?
An RFI is a question that clarifies the design. A change order is a formal change to the contract's scope, price, or schedule, often the result of an RFI.

What is a pay application in construction?
A pay application is the formal request a contractor submits to get paid for work completed in a billing period, usually on AIA G702 and G703 forms, showing the schedule of values, percent complete, retainage, and the amount due.

What is a WIP report in construction?
A work-in-progress (WIP) report shows, for each active job, how much you've earned versus how much you've billed, along with cost, percent complete, and projected margin. It's the core report for knowing whether your jobs and your company are actually profitable.
What's the difference between over-billing and under-billing?
Over-billing means you've billed more than you've earned to date (billings in excess of costs). Under-billing means you've earned more than you've billed (costs in excess of billings). Over-billing borrows against future work; under-billing means you're financing the job with your own cash.
What are costs in excess of billings?
It's the accounting term for under-billing: the value of work you've completed but haven't billed yet. It shows up as an asset on the balance sheet, and as a cash-flow drag in real life.
How do I read a WIP report?
Compare the percent complete to the percent billed for each job. If you've earned more than you've billed, you're under-billed; if you've billed more than you've earned, you're over-billed. Then watch projected margin against the original estimate to catch fade.
What is construction cash-flow forecasting?
It's a forward look at the cash coming into and going out of your business (draws, AR, payroll, payables, retainage) so you can see when you'll be short before it happens, rather than finding out on a Friday.

What's the difference between project costing and WIP reporting?
Project costing tracks cost against budget on a single job in detail. WIP rolls every job up into the earned-versus-billed and margin picture for the whole company. Costing is the job-level view; WIP is the portfolio view.

What causes margin to look fine on paper but fade in reality?
Underestimated costs, unapproved or under-priced change orders, labor overruns, and slow reactions in the field. Each is small on its own, but together they eat the margin between the estimate and the final numbers.
What is AR aging in construction?
AR aging groups your unpaid invoices by how long they've been outstanding (0-30, 31-60, 61-90, 90+ days), so you can see who owes you, how old the debt is, and where collections are slipping.

What are the G702 and G703 forms?
They're the standard AIA construction billing forms. The G702 is the application and certificate for payment (the summary), and the G703 is the continuation sheet that breaks the billing down by each line of the schedule of values.
Who fills out a pay application, the PM or accounting?
Usually both. The PM knows how complete each line is, and accounting assembles and submits it. Nova drafts it from your job data so the PM reviews instead of rebuilding, and finance gets a number it can defend.

What is a cost-to-complete forecast in construction?
It's your estimate of the remaining cost to finish a job, added to the costs already incurred, to project the final cost and margin. It's the number that drives your WIP and your profitability, and the hardest one to get right.
What's the difference between cost, revenue, and cash forecasting?
Cost forecasting projects what a job will cost to finish. Revenue forecasting projects what you'll bill and recognize. Cash forecasting projects when the money actually moves. Nova runs all three off the same data so they agree.

Is it normal to be profitable but cash-poor in construction?
Yes. It's one of the most common cash problems in the industry, driven by retainage, slow receivables, and fronting labor and materials before you're paid. Profit is booked when you bill; the cash arrives much later.
How do I fix a cash-flow problem on a profitable project?
Forecast your cash so you see the shortfall early, then accelerate the receivables causing it, for example, by getting paid early on an unpaid invoice instead of waiting 60 days. Nova shows the gap for free and lets you close it with QuickPay Direct.
What's the difference between over- and under-billing?
Over-billing means you've billed more than you've earned. Under-billing means you've earned more than you've billed. Under-billing hides a cash problem behind a healthy-looking P&L.
Is under-billing bad?
It can be. It means you're financing your customer's project with your own cash, and your reported profit is outpacing your billing. Catching it lets you bill for work you've already done.
Where do I see it on a WIP report?
It shows up as "costs in excess of billings." Compare percent complete to percent billed on each job; if you've earned more than you've billed, you're under-billed.
What is margin fade?
Margin fade is when a job's profit shrinks between the estimate and the final numbers, usually a little each month, which is why it's often caught too late.
How do I prevent margin fade?
Track each job's margin as costs and change orders come in, promptly price and approve change orders, and act on labor overruns early. Nova flags the fade while you can still fix it.
When should I catch it?
As early as possible, well before close. The whole point is to see it while you can still change the outcome, not discover it in the final accounting.

Is pay-if-paid legal in my state?
It depends on the state. Many limit or refuse to enforce pay-if-paid clauses because they shift the risk of nonpayment onto the sub. Check your state's rules and read the contract closely.
What's a reasonable time under pay-when-paid?
Pay-when-paid gives the GC a reasonable time to pay the sub after the GC is paid. What counts as reasonable varies by contract and state, but it affects the timing of payment, not whether you get paid.
How do subs protect their cash flow?
Know which clause you've signed, forecast the payment gap it creates, and have a way to bridge it, such as getting paid early on the invoice while you wait. Nova helps you see the gap and cover it.
What's a typical retainage percentage?
Usually 5% to 10% of each payment, withheld until the job is substantially or fully complete.
When is retainage released?
At substantial or final completion, per your contract, which can be months after you finish your part. For subs, it's often the last money in.
Can I finance retainage?
Retainage is excluded from QuickPay Direct advances, so it isn't factored, but seeing it in your cash forecast lets you plan around it and get paid faster on the rest.
